Auburn Asian Welfare Centre (AAWC) is looking for a Full Time General Manager to offer welfare and community services for the local residents of Auburn multicultural community.

 

Position Details

Position Title: General Manager

Employment basis: Full-time – 35 hours per week. The position is a permanent position (subject to 3-month probation period)

Remuneration: Based on relevant qualification and experience, the salary range for the position is $73K - $75K per annum – in accordance with the Social & Community Services Employees (State) Award

 

About Us

Auburn Asian Welfare Centre - We are an independent, not for profit organization that provides support for those migrating from Asian countries to settle successfully into the Australian mainstream society. AAWC aims to provide a leading role in the Asian community within the Auburn LGA, by offering services and programs that empower individuals within the community to have an improved quality of life, equal access to appropriate services and a coordinated response to community issues.

    Essential selection criteria:

    • Qualified social worker or degree in social and community welfare education with experience in social welfare services (tertiary or Diploma of community services)
    • Fluency in speaking English, Cantonese and Mandarin, able to write English and Chinese
    • Understanding mainstream and Asian social and community services with demonstrated ability to promote services in the Asian community
    • Competent computer skills in data entry, website development and related programs
    • Ability to set up a practical management system for ensuring accountability with staff, the management committee, funding providers and the Asian community
    • Knowledge, skills and experience in working independently or as a team in running centre base activities for the individual and groups
    • Capability and experience in community networking and collaboration with network for community development
    • Sound understanding of the centre’s financial affairs and the financial reporting system
    • Contribute to building a sustainable organisation

     

    Desirable criteria:

    • Ability to drive and secure funding and financial partnership opportunities and delivering on our funding agreements outcomes.
    • Current NSW driver’s licence and a reliable vehicle for work purpose

     

    Roles and responsibilities

    • Provide overall direction and management of the centre, including developing, implementing and monitoring procedures, policies and standards for the centre and administrative staff
    • planning, developing, coordinating and administering educational, training, welfare and support programs and services to meet the needs of clients
    • preparing applications/submissions for funding and resources and reports to government bodies and other agencies
    • report to Management Committee and Funding body
    • interviewing clients and assessing the nature and extent of difficulties, as well as assisting clients by providing support and information
    • acting as a mediator and referring clients to appropriate community organisations/agencies that can provide additional help or specialised services
    • liaising with other welfare providers, community organisations, government bodies, boards and funding bodies to discuss about community issues and promoting awareness of community resources and services, also provide measures to improve existing services and facilities and develop new services
    • controlling administrative operations such as budget planning and forecasts, report preparation, monitoring and controlling expenditure, equipment and services
    • representing the Centre in negotiations, and at conventions, seminars, public hearings and forums
    • administer programs with staff, recruit and train staff & volunteers
    • advocate on behalf of clients in their dealings with government departments or service delivery agencies to ensure access and appropriate levels of service
    • Undertake other duties and responsibilities within the scope of this role, as directed
